WebViburnum dentatum ‘Morton’. Selected by Synnestvedt Nursery Company, Round Lake, Illinois, for its uniform oval-rounded habit, attractive foliage, strong branching, and wine-red to burgundy fall color. Creamy white flowers appear in early to mid-June, followed by ornamental clusters of blue-black fruit in autumn.
